Full Description
{1}Remains of an earlier post medieval building were present in Trench 4, comprising of four ironstone walls and one of brick. The building had been partially removed by garden terracing and the construction of a sunken garden. No floors survived but and area of burnt stones, possibly a hearth, and stones forming the base of a stone lined pit may have been associated. A fence line seen in pit evidence post dates the demolition of the stone building.
